Item type:Publication, Practical CRIS Interoperability(euroCRIS, 2018-06-15); ; Institutional Current Research Information Systems typically interoperate and interact with a rich variety of other information systems and services. We aim at providing a basic list and discussing the motivations, the technical aspects of the information interchange that is taking place, and potential benefits of applying CERIF. Our findings are illustrated on the example of a home-built university CRIS with almost two decades of history. - Some of the metrics are blocked by yourconsent settings
Item type:Publication, Monitoring ORCID adoption using a national and an institutional CRIS(euroCRIS, 2024-05-17); ; We evaluate the level of adoption of ORCID identifiers based on the data of the Czech national CRIS and of the ORCID public data dump. By analyzing this data we establish the proportion of researchers with ORCID profiles. We look into the level of activity of these profiles and we also study the ramp-up periods of reporting ORCID iDs by Czech research performing organizations. A section of this picture is further refined using an institutional CRIS: we identify key factors that predict the level of activity of the ORCID records. We also describe the process and timeline of collecting of ORCID iDs in the CTU institutional CRIS. We observe that the adoption of ORCID iDs by researchers in Czech research performing organizations is underway, but far from complete. Institutions’ level of adoption and reporting vary considerably, showing that different institutions are at different stages of the adoption curve. An example shows that with time the adoption can become close to complete. - Some of the metrics are blocked by yourconsent settings
Item type:Publication, “Where have all the papers gone?”: Investigating why some papers are not reported in a CRIS(euroCRIS, 2022-05-14); ; We investigate the extent, the variation by discipline and the reasons for some papers to have affiliation to an institution, but not be reported in the institutional CRIS. We compare the contents of the institutional CRIS of the Czech Technical University against the Web of Science database. - Some of the metrics are blocked by yourconsent settings
Item type:Publication, Institutional Scientific Output and Citation Coverage in OpenAlex: The Case of the Czech Technical University in Prague(euroCRIS, 2026-05-21); ; The Czech Technical University in Prague (ROR ID https://ror.org/03kqpb082; CTU in the sequel) runs its in-house built institutional CRIS called V3S (https://doi.org/10.1016/j.procs.2019.01.077) which covers the institution’s scholarly output since the 1990-ies. CTU relies on the Web of Science and Scopus citation databases for signaling new publications of its authors and for tracking citations. An earlier (2019) attempt to evaluate the level of coverage of citations in an open information source (https://doi.org/10.2478/jdis-2020-0037) showed an unsatisfactory level of coverage.
